(07 April 2013) Alchemy (Metal Mind (Poland) MASS CD 1469 DGD, 2013), the rock musical by Clive Nolan has been released as a two-CD set. The gorgeously packaged tri-fold digipak double release with full color libretto was preceded by the world premiere of the musical show at the famous Wyspianski Theatre in Katowice, Poland in February. The show was recorded for the purposes of a DVD which will be released by Metal Mind Productions later this year.

Alchemy is a Victorian adventure set in 1842, with a sense of the dark and mysterious. The lyrics and book are both by Clive Nolan, a British musician, composer and producer who has played a prominent role in the recent development of progressive and symphonic rock. Next to Clive Nolan himself, both the CD album and the forthcoming DVD concert version of the musical feature artists well known in progressive rock including, Tracy Hitchings (Landmarq, Strangers on a Train), Andy Sears (Twelfth Night), Paul Manzi (Arena), Damian Wilson (Threshold, Star One), David Clifford (Red Jasper) as well as the leading lady of Nolan's previous musical She, Agnieszka Swita.

The main cast of the show was expanded by the stars of the She Cheltenham theatre production, including stunning female vocalists Victoria Bolley and Soheila Clifford (live performance and DVD, not the CD) as well as Chris Lewis. On the Alchemy CD set, the role of Jessamine was sung by the stunning Noel Calcaterra, a Uruguayan singer/actress, and the voice of Clive Nolan's 2010 South American Otra Vida musical project.

The Caamora Company musicians--including Clive Nolan (keyboards), Mark Westwood (guitars), Scott Higham (drums), Claudio Momberg (keyboards) and Kylan Amos (bass)--were responsible for the instrumental part of the project both on a CD and DVD.

Clive Nolan comments, "For me, the creation of Alchemy has been a three-year journey so far. I have lived with the growing story and the developing music almost on a daily basis. It has become an integral part of my life. Recording the CD, in many ways, helps to provide an official stamp on the project!"

Alchemy's musical themes are gorgeous. The arrangements are superb, and the vocals are amazing. Performances by each of the female vocalists are stunning and we were especially pleased to hear the contributions to a Clive Nolan Musical by Tracy Hitchings. Perhaps they will make the third Strangers On A Train album!

Listeners will adore the delivery of the musical's female parts played by Victoria Bolley (Eva), and Noel Calcaterra (Jassamine). In fact, if you have not heard Nolan's Otra Vida before reading this article, you must do so now. Also from the Cheltenham run of She, Soheila Clifford, a young singer, actress and model, delivers the role of a mercenary on the CD but performed Jassamine in the Poland live performance of the musical.

In addition to delivering music that spans Clive Nolan's styles, Alchemy includes several musical themes that span the project. The majority of the female vocal work on the project is sung by Agnieszka Swita. A stunning West End-style ballad stands out. Entitled "Share This Dream," the song is sung by Victoria Bolley whose delivery provides allusions to the world famous Sarah Brightman.

Nolan continued, "Alchemy is for me the biggest musical and artistic challenge I have ever attempted. I really didn't expect a bigger mountain to climb than the She project, but I was wrong. This show is simply larger in structure and depth. By the time we do the Cheltenham shows, it will have been four years of my life!"

Alchemy has proven to be an outstanding work that is extremely well produced, performed with style and pinache and whose story is delivered perfectly through song. Listen most carefully to songs involving several of the players, especially "Treachery" near the conclusion of the musical. These clearly illustrate significant growth from She and point to the continued development of Clive Nolan's style. The two-CD set is fabulous. Bravo!
